The Role of Supplements in Modern Health

The body requires a variety of nutrients to work properly, from minerals and vitamins to amino acids, antioxidants, and enzymes. These necessary nutrients are needed for different physical processes, consisting of power manufacturing, immune function, cell repair, and a lot more. While a well-rounded diet plan is ideal, it is not constantly feasible for individuals to consume all the essential nutrients from food alone due to different variables such as dietary limitations, food top quality, and individual health conditions.

Supplements supply a convenient service to attend to these voids. They are available in different kinds, including capsules, tablet computers, powders, and fluids, and are designed to provide certain nutrients in focused amounts. For example, individuals who battle to obtain enough vitamin D from sunlight or food sources might gain from a vitamin D supplement to support bone health and immune function. Likewise, omega-3 fats, which are largely located in fish, can be consumed through supplements by individuals who do not eat fish on a regular basis.

Sorts of Supplements and Their Benefits

Multivitamins: One of the most common supplements, multivitamins include a combination of necessary nutrients. These supplements are specifically beneficial for individuals with nutrient deficiencies or those following restrictive diet plans. Multivitamins support general health, energy levels, and immune function, making them a prominent option for everyday supplements.

Vitamin D: Often described as the "sunshine vitamin," vitamin D is vital for bone health, body immune system feature, and the guideline of calcium and phosphorus levels in the body. Vitamin D deficiencies are common, particularly in individuals who spend minimal time outdoors or stay in areas with reduced sunshine direct exposure.

Omega-3 Fatty Acids: Omega-3 fatty acids, discovered in fish oil and certain plant oils, are important for heart health, brain function, and lowering swelling in the body. These supplements are frequently taken by individuals that do not take in enough fatty fish in their diets.

Probiotics: Probiotics are real-time microorganisms and yeasts that are helpful for digestive tract health. They assist maintain a healthy equilibrium of digestive tract plants, support food digestion, and enhance the immune system. Probiotic supplements are frequently used to boost digestion health, especially after antibiotic use or to take care of problems such as irritable digestive tract disorder (IBS).

Protein Supplements: Protein is essential for muscular tissue growth, repair, and total body function. Protein supplements, such as whey healthy protein or plant-based protein powders, are popular amongst athletes, body builders, and individuals seeking to increase their healthy protein intake for health supplement and fitness and healing purposes.

Herbal Supplements: Herbal supplements, such as turmeric extract, echinacea, and ginseng, have been made use of for centuries in traditional medicine for their healing properties. These supplements are often considered their anti-inflammatory, immune-boosting, or stress-relieving effects.

Calcium and Magnesium: These 2 minerals are crucial for bone health, muscular tissue function, and nerve transmission. Calcium and magnesium supplements are usually suggested for individuals with weakening of bones, muscle mass pains, or other problems associated with mineral shortages.

How to Choose the Right Supplements

When it involves choosing supplements, it's crucial to understand your individual health requirements. Factors such as age, gender, way of living, and health conditions play a substantial role in identifying which supplements might be advantageous for you. Consulting with a doctor or a nutritionist is always advised prior to starting any type of supplement routine, as they can help you examine any kind of deficiencies and offer personalized referrals.

It is also important to pick high-quality supplements from credible brands. Look for products that are third-party evaluated for purity and effectiveness, making certain that they contain the specified active ingredients and do not have harmful pollutants. Furthermore, supplements must be taken as routed on the label to stay clear of overconsumption, which can lead to unfavorable impacts.

The Role of Supplements in Preventive Health

Supplements not only sustain current health requirements however additionally play a duty in preventative health. As an example, taking anti-oxidants such as vitamin C, vitamin E, and selenium can help in reducing oxidative stress and anxiety in the body, which is linked to chronic conditions such as heart disease and cancer. Similarly, calcium and vitamin D supplements can avoid the beginning of osteoporosis by preserving bone density in time.

Supplements can likewise support immune health, particularly during periods of stress, illness, or increased exposure to infections. Vitamin C, zinc, and probiotics are commonly used to boost immune feature and lower the intensity of colds or various other infections.

For individuals with certain health conditions, supplements can function as a vital part of a comprehensive management plan. As an example, individuals with anemia might take advantage of iron supplements, while those with arthritis may find remedy for joint discomfort through supplements containing glucosamine and chondroitin.

Debunking Myths About Supplements

Regardless of the expanding popularity of supplements, there are still many false impressions bordering their use. One common misconception is that supplements can replace a healthy diet regimen. While supplements are useful for filling nutrient voids, they must not be used as a substitute for a well balanced diet plan rich in entire foods. Entire foods provide a series of nutrients, fiber, and bioactive substances that work together to sustain health, which can not be duplicated by supplements alone.

An additional misconception is that more is far better when it concerns supplements. Taking too much quantities of vitamins or minerals can lead to poisoning and negative negative effects. For example, way too much vitamin A can trigger liver damages, while excess iron can cause gastrointestinal problems. It's important to comply with the recommended does and consult with a doctor to avoid any type of possible dangers.
